The Dehydrating Effect of Air Conditioning
Air conditioning works by removing moisture from the air, creating a dry environment. This low humidity can strip the skin of its natural oils, leading to dryness, irritation, and potentially exacerbating acne.
- Reduced Sebum Production: Dry air can decrease sebum production, the skin’s natural oil. While sebum is often associated with acne, a complete lack of it can disrupt the skin’s barrier function, making it more vulnerable to irritation and breakouts. This is because a healthy amount of sebum helps maintain a protective layer.
- Increased Skin Sensitivity: Dehydrated skin becomes more sensitive and prone to irritation. Minor abrasions or friction can easily lead to inflammation, potentially worsening existing acne or causing new breakouts.
- Compromised Skin Barrier: The skin’s outermost layer acts as a protective barrier. Dryness weakens this barrier, making your skin more susceptible to bacteria and other environmental irritants which can contribute to acne.
How Dry Skin Contributes to Acne
While initially counterintuitive, extremely dry skin can actually worsen acne. The skin’s response to dryness is often increased oil production to compensate, potentially leading to clogged pores and breakouts.
- Compensation for Dryness: When the skin is excessively dry, it attempts to counteract this by producing more oil, leading to clogged pores and an increased risk of acne.
- Increased Skin Cell Shedding: Dry skin can lead to an increase in dead skin cell buildup. This buildup can clog pores and contribute to the formation of acne lesions.
- Inflammation: Dry, irritated skin is more prone to inflammation, which can worsen the appearance and severity of acne.

Indoor Air Pollutants and Acne
Air conditioning systems, while cooling, can also circulate dust, pollen, and other allergens. These pollutants can irritate the skin and contribute to acne breakouts.
- Dust Mites: Air conditioning systems can harbor dust mites, microscopic creatures that thrive in humid environments. Their droppings can trigger allergic reactions and inflammation in acne-prone skin.
- Mold Spores: Improperly maintained air conditioning systems can foster the growth of mold and mildew. Mold spores can irritate the skin and aggravate existing acne.
- Pollen: Even with air conditioning, pollen can still enter indoor spaces. For those with pollen allergies, this can lead to skin inflammation and exacerbate acne.
Maintaining Good Indoor Air Quality
Regular cleaning and maintenance of air conditioning units are vital for preventing the accumulation of pollutants and improving indoor air quality. This will help minimize irritation and breakouts related to air conditioning.
- Regularly change air filters in your AC units. A clean filter helps remove dust, pollen, and other irritants. Replace filters at least every 3 months, or more frequently depending on usage and air quality.
- Schedule professional AC maintenance at least once a year. A technician can inspect your system for any issues, like mold growth, and ensure it is functioning properly.

Genetics and Hormones
Genetic predisposition and hormonal fluctuations play a significant role in acne development. Understanding these factors is important for long-term acne management.
- Genetics: A family history of acne increases the likelihood of developing the condition. Genetic factors influence sebum production, pore size, and the skin’s inflammatory response.
- Hormones: Hormonal changes during puberty, menstruation, and pregnancy can trigger or worsen acne. Hormones influence sebum production and inflammation.
Diet and Lifestyle
Dietary habits and lifestyle choices also impact skin health and acne. A balanced diet, proper hydration, and stress management can improve skin clarity.
- Diet: A diet high in processed foods, sugary drinks, and dairy products has been linked to increased acne severity. A balanced diet rich in fruits, vegetables, and whole grains is generally beneficial.
- Stress: Stress hormones can exacerbate acne. Effective stress management techniques, such as exercise, yoga, or meditation, can help improve skin health.
- Hygiene: Maintaining proper skin hygiene is essential for preventing acne breakouts. This includes gentle cleansing and avoiding harsh scrubbing.

Myth 1: Air Conditioning Directly Causes Acne
While air conditioning can indirectly contribute to acne by drying out the skin and reducing humidity, it does not directly cause acne. The link is through the effects on skin hydration and sensitivity, not a direct causal relationship.
Myth 2: All Air Conditioning is Bad for Skin
The impact of air conditioning on skin health depends largely on factors like the humidity level maintained, regular maintenance of the unit, and individual skin sensitivity.

Can using a humidifier help combat the drying effects of air conditioning?
Yes, using a humidifier in air-conditioned spaces can help increase humidity levels and prevent excessive dryness, which in turn can help manage skin health and reduce the risk of acne related to dry skin. It’s important to ensure the humidifier is clean to avoid introducing new irritants.
Is there a correlation between temperature and acne breakouts?
While high temperatures and humidity can worsen acne for some individuals due to increased sweating and potential for clogged pores, extreme dryness caused by air conditioning can also negatively impact the skin and potentially worsen acne through other mechanisms.
Should I wash my face more frequently if I use air conditioning?
No, over-washing your face can actually strip your skin of its natural oils and further dry it out, potentially exacerbating acne. Stick to a gentle cleansing routine, one to two times a day, using a mild, non-comedogenic cleanser.
What are some good skincare products for skin affected by air conditioning?
Look for hydrating and gentle cleansers, moisturizers, and serums that are specifically designed for acne-prone or sensitive skin. Ingredients like hyaluronic acid are known for their hydrating capabilities. Consult a dermatologist for personalized recommendations.
My acne worsened after installing an AC unit. What should I do?
If you suspect your air conditioning is contributing to your acne, try using a humidifier, ensure proper AC maintenance and consider consulting a dermatologist to discuss your skincare routine and potential treatment options.
